First Squad detectives are looking for a man who used a black handgun to rob a Baldwin gas station early Monday, Nassau County police said.

At about 3:52 a.m., a man entered Mobil Gas at 1214 Grand Ave., displayed the gun and demanded money from a 44-year-old male employee.

After getting an undetermined amount of cash, the suspect, wearing dark clothing, then fled on foot.

Police said no injuries were reported.
